Waging battles: Author income in Australia

The book industry begins with authors. They toil for hours to release their ideas on the page, but each day they also struggle with making ends meet. Elizabeth Flux looks at author income. In a 2015 report, professor David Throsby noted that fewer than β€˜one in 20 (4.9%) authors earn...
